			<abstract xml:lang="ru"><p>Разработка и верификация итеративной методики краткосрочного прогнозирования трудоемкости ремонтов для адаптивного планирования технического обслуживания на ранних этапах цифровой трансформации, когда доступны лишь ограниченные данные начального периода эксплуатации (до 160 тыс. км). На массиве из 100 реальных заявок проведен сравнительный анализ методов машинного обучения: градиентного бустинга (XGBoost, LightGBM), рекуррентных нейронных сетей (LSTM, GRU) и полиномиальной регрессии 5-го порядка. Ключевым критерием эффективности выбрана ошибка прогноза на один плановый межсервисный интервал вперед (MAE_ext). Алгоритм XGBoost показал наилучший баланс между точностью интерполяции (R²=0.89) и устойчивостью к краткосрочной экстраполяции (MAE_ext=0.55), превзойдя полиномиальные модели. На его основе предложен методологический фреймворк, основанный на принципе «скользящего горизонта прогнозирования» и циклическом переобучении. Новизна работы заключается в адаптации парадигмы онлайн/инкрементального обучения для прикладной задачи управления сервисом парка техники и интерпретации прогнозных коэффициентов как метрик операционного риска. Практическая значимость – в предложении научно обоснованного, осторожного подхода к запуску предиктивного обслуживания, минимизирующего риски решений на основе некорректной экстраполяции.</p></abstract><trans-abstract xml:lang="en"><p>Development and verification of an iterative methodology for short-term forecasting of repair labor intensity for adaptive maintenance planning at the early stages of digital transformation, when only limited initial operating-period data are available (up to 160 thousand km). A comparative analysis of machine learning methods was carried out on a dataset of 100 repair requests: gradient boosting (XGBoost, LightGBM), recurrent neural networks (LSTM, GRU), and fifth-degree polynomial regression. The key efficiency criterion was the forecast error for one scheduled service interval ahead (MAE_ext). The XGBoost algorithm demonstrated the best balance between interpolation accuracy (R²=0.89) and resistance to short-term extrapolation (MAE_ext=0.55), outperforming polynomial models. On this basis, a methodological framework was proposed that relies on the rolling forecasting horizon principle and cyclic retraining. The novelty of the study consists in adapting the online/incremental learning paradigm to the applied problem of fleet service management and in interpreting forecast coefficients as operational risk metrics. The practical significance lies in proposing a scientifically grounded and cautious approach to launching predictive maintenance, minimizing the risks of decisions based on incorrect extrapolation.</p></trans-abstract><kwd-group xml:lang="en"><title>Keywords</title><kwd>predictive maintenance</kwd><kwd>machine learning</kwd><kwd>gradient boosting</kwd><kwd>iterative learning</kwd><kwd>limited data</kwd><kwd>telematics</kwd><kwd>labor intensity forecasting</kwd><kwd>risk management</kwd></kwd-group><kwd-group xml:lang="ru"><title>Ключевые слова</title><kwd>предиктивное обслуживание</kwd><kwd>машинное обучение</kwd><kwd>градиентный бустинг</kwd><kwd>итеративное обучение</kwd><kwd>ограниченные данные</kwd><kwd>телематика</kwd><kwd>прогнозирование трудоемкости</kwd><kwd>управление рисками</kwd></kwd-group><funding-group>
